Buying Guide for the Best Pickleball Ball

Choosing the right pickleball ball can significantly impact your game experience. The type of ball you select should match your playing environment and skill level. Understanding the key specifications will help you make an informed decision and enhance your performance on the court.
Indoor vs. OutdoorPickleball balls are designed specifically for either indoor or outdoor play. Indoor balls are typically lighter, have larger holes, and are softer, which makes them easier to control and less affected by wind. Outdoor balls are heavier, have smaller holes, and are more durable to withstand rougher surfaces and weather conditions. Choose indoor balls if you play in a gym or other indoor facility, and outdoor balls if you play on outdoor courts.
Ball DurabilityDurability refers to how long the ball will last before it needs to be replaced. Outdoor balls tend to be more durable due to their thicker plastic and smaller holes, which help them withstand the elements and rough surfaces. Indoor balls, while less durable, offer better control and are less likely to crack. If you play frequently or in competitive settings, you may want to opt for more durable balls to avoid frequent replacements.
Ball WeightThe weight of the ball affects its speed and control. Heavier balls, typically used for outdoor play, are less affected by wind and can travel faster, making them suitable for more aggressive play. Lighter balls, used for indoor play, offer better control and are easier to maneuver. Consider your playing style and environment when choosing the ball weight; if you prefer a faster game, go for heavier balls, and if you value control, opt for lighter ones.
Ball ColorThe color of the ball can impact visibility during play. Bright colors like yellow, orange, and neon green are commonly used because they are easier to see against various backgrounds and lighting conditions. Choose a color that provides the best contrast with your playing environment to ensure you can track the ball easily during play.
Ball BounceThe bounce of the ball affects how it responds to hits and the overall pace of the game. Indoor balls generally have a higher bounce due to their lighter weight and larger holes, making them easier to control. Outdoor balls have a lower bounce, which can make the game faster and more challenging. Consider your skill level and playing preference when choosing the ball bounce; beginners may prefer a higher bounce for easier control, while advanced players might enjoy the challenge of a lower bounce.
